Read2021 UK Adspend forecast for slower recovery
The latest Advertising Association/WARC Expenditure Report has downgraded its 2021 forecast to a return-to-growth of 14.4%, lower than the figure of 16.6% predicted in July. Growth in 2021 will fall just short of offsetting this year’s losses completely, meaning the UK’s ad market is now not expected to recover fully until 2022.
